Interaction Support for Visual Comparison Inspired by Natural Behavior

摘要

Visual comparison is an intrinsic part of interactive data exploration and analysis. The literature provides a large body of existing solutions that help users accomplish comparison tasks. These solutions are mostly of visual nature and custom-made for specific data. We ask the question if a more general support is possible by focusing on the interaction aspect of comparison tasks. As an answer to this question, we propose a novel interaction concept that is inspired by real-world behavior of people comparing information printed on paper. In line with real-world interaction, our approach supports users (1) in interactively specifying pieces of graphical information to be compared, (2) in flexibly arranging these pieces on the screen, and (3) in performing the actual comparison of side-by-side and overlapping arrangements of the graphical information. Complementary visual cues and add-ons further assist users in carrying out comparison tasks. Our concept and the integrated interaction techniques are generally applicable and can be coupled with different visualization techniques. We implemented an interactive prototype and conducted a qualitative user study to assess the concept’s usefulness in the context of three different visualization techniques. The obtained feedback indicates that our interaction techniques mimic the natural behavior quite well, can be learned quickly, and are easy to apply to visual comparison tasks.
机译:视觉比较是交互式数据探索和分析的固有部分。文献提供了大量现有解决方案,可帮助用户完成比较任务。这些解决方案大多具有视觉性质,并针对特定数据进行了定制。我们问一个问题,通过关注比较任务的交互方面,是否可以提供更一般的支持。为了回答这个问题,我们提出了一种新颖的交互概念,该概念受到人们比较纸上印刷的信息的现实世界行为的启发。与现实世界的互动相一致,我们的方法支持用户(1)以交互方式指定要比较的图形信息;(2)灵活地将这些信息布置在屏幕上;以及(3)进行侧面的实际比较。图形信息的并行排列和重叠排列。互补的视觉提示和附加组件可进一步帮助用户执行比较任务。我们的概念和集成的交互技术通常适用,并且可以与不同的可视化技术结合使用。我们实施了一个交互式原型,并进行了定性用户研究,以在三种不同的可视化技术范围内评估该概念的实用性。所获得的反馈表明,我们的交互技术很好地模仿了自然行为,可以快速学习,并且易于应用于视觉比较任务。
